    Job description

    Aureos are seeking a HV Contracts Coordinator to cover COMA (Control of Operations and Maintenance Agreements) and OMA (Operations and Maintenance Agreements) from our Plymouth Strategic Private Networks Depot covering the Southwest.


    This role will report to the HV (High Voltage) Manager and in conjunction with the SAPs (Senior Authorised Persons) and will be responsible to deliver High voltage Inspections and Maintenance contracts to our key clients.


    All necessary systems training will be given with an agreed progression route and necessary mentoring in place. Support to the business, and other departments as required.


    Tasks and duties


    • Will be based within the Plymouth HV office.
    • To monitor and update client inspection and maintenance dates and requirements.
    • To monitor, update and plan work programme.
    • Ensure documents are templated correctly.
    • To provide competitive quotations for annual inspections and planned maintenance of HV private network equipment.
    • Liaise with suppliers and order necessary materials for works as required.
    • To monitor and issue waste transfer documentation as necessary.
    • To prepare associated job packs and health and safety plans.
    • To prepare inspection/maintenance reports and issue to client.
    • Liaise with engineers/technicians to form quotations for any remedial works required.
    • Liaise with administration team to raise work orders, purchase orders & invoices as necessary.
    • To monitor progress of works and notify manager of forecasted revenue.
    • To monitor stock levels of insulating oil and essential spares.
